Regular maintenance is vital for a portable generator that is in storage. Proper upkeep ensures it operates efficiently when needed. Consider these maintenance tips:
-
Fuel Stabilization: Use fuel stabilizers to prevent degradation.
-
Battery Care: Disconnect the battery if storing for an extended period.
-
Regular Inspections: Check for signs of wear or damage periodically.

Portable Generator Long-Term Storage Tips
Proper long-term storage of a portable generator is essential to ensure its reliability and performance when you need it most. This section provides expert-tested tips for maintaining your generator in optimal condition, covering everything from ideal storage locations to necessary maintenance steps. Implementing these strategies will help extend the life of your generator and ensure it’s ready for any situation.
If you plan to store your portable generator for an extended period, consider these long-term storage guidelines:
-
Draining Fuel: Drain fuel to prevent degradation.
-
Covering: Use a breathable cover to protect against dust.
-
Regular Checks: Schedule periodic checks to ensure it remains in good condition.
